当前位置: 首页 > news >正文

AntdUI深度解析:让传统WinForm应用焕发现代化设计魅力

AntdUI深度解析:让传统WinForm应用焕发现代化设计魅力

【免费下载链接】AntdUI👚 基于 Ant Design 设计语言的 Winform 界面库项目地址: https://gitcode.com/AntdUI/AntdUI

还在为WinForm应用的界面设计而头疼吗?那些单调的按钮、老旧的表单、缺乏设计感的布局,是否让你在项目评审时感到尴尬?今天,我将带你深入了解AntdUI这个革命性的WinForm界面库,看看它是如何让传统桌面应用重获新生的。

开发痛点:WinForm界面设计的困境

在传统的WinForm开发中,开发者常常陷入这样的困境:要么忍受系统默认控件的简陋样式,要么投入大量时间精力来自定义绘制。更糟糕的是,即使花费了巨大代价,最终效果也往往差强人意。

常见问题包括

  • 界面风格不一致,缺乏整体设计感
  • 控件样式单一,难以满足现代化审美需求
  • 自定义绘制复杂,开发效率低下
  • 缺乏响应式设计,在不同DPI屏幕上显示效果不佳

解决方案:AntdUI带来的设计革命

AntdUI基于Ant Design设计语言,为WinForm开发带来了全新的设计理念。它通过纯GDI绘图技术,实现了高质量的抗锯齿渲染效果,让你的应用界面焕然一新。

核心优势体现在

  • 零依赖渲染:无需图片资源,所有视觉效果通过代码绘制
  • 主题系统完善:内置明暗双主题,支持一键切换
  • 完美DPI适配:自动适应不同分辨率,确保显示效果一致
  • 组件生态丰富:提供50+精心设计的控件,覆盖各种应用场景

极速入门:三步开启现代化界面之旅

第一步:获取AntdUI库

通过GitCode仓库直接获取最新源码:

git clone https://gitcode.com/AntdUI/AntdUI

或者使用NuGet包管理器快速安装:

第二步:配置开发环境

确保你的项目满足以下要求:

  • Visual Studio 2019或更高版本
  • .NET Framework 4.0+ 或 .NET 6.0+
  • 启用GDI+绘图支持

第三步:应用AntdUI样式

在主窗口的OnLoad方法中添加以下代码:

protected override void OnLoad(EventArgs e) { // 设置应用主题 Config.SetTheme(ThemeType.Light); // 应用AntdUI设计风格 this.SetAntdStyle(); base.OnLoad(e); }

特色功能:三大核心组件深度体验

智能表格组件

AntdUI的表格控件彻底改变了传统数据展示方式。它不仅支持基本的排序、筛选功能,还提供了丰富的单元格类型和交互效果。

表格组件的亮点

  • 支持多种单元格类型(文本、按钮、开关、标签等)
  • 内置加载状态和错误处理
  • 灵活的列配置和自定义渲染

实时聊天界面

对于需要即时通讯功能的应用,AntdUI提供了完整的聊天界面解决方案。从消息气泡到用户头像,从时间戳到未读提醒,每一个细节都经过精心设计。

状态反馈系统

加载状态、进度提示、错误反馈——这些细节决定了用户体验的质量。AntdUI的Spin组件能够优雅地处理各种异步操作场景。

进阶技巧:提升开发效率的实用方法

主题定制化开发

除了内置的明暗主题,你还可以深度定制自己的主题风格。通过修改颜色配置,实现品牌色的完美融入。

性能优化策略

AntdUI在设计时就充分考虑了性能因素。通过双缓冲技术、懒加载机制等手段,确保即使在复杂界面下也能保持流畅运行。

资源导航:学习路径与技术支持

项目提供了完善的技术文档和示例代码,你可以在以下路径中找到相关资源:

  • 核心组件源码:src/AntdUI/Controls/
  • 官方示例项目:example/Demo/
  • 设计规范文档:doc/wiki/en/Control/

总结:为什么AntdUI值得你尝试

AntdUI不仅仅是一个UI组件库,它代表了一种全新的WinForm开发理念。通过统一的设计语言、高性能的渲染技术和丰富的组件生态,它让传统桌面应用开发焕发新的活力。

无论你是正在维护老项目的开发者,还是准备开始新项目的技术负责人,AntdUI都能为你提供专业级的界面开发体验。从今天开始,用AntdUI打造属于你的现代化WinForm应用!

【免费下载链接】AntdUI👚 基于 Ant Design 设计语言的 Winform 界面库项目地址: https://gitcode.com/AntdUI/AntdUI

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/176084/

相关文章:

  • stduuid完整使用指南:从基础入门到高级应用
  • 深度噪声抑制实战指南:从嘈杂环境到清晰语音的完整解决方案
  • 动漫下载加速新方案:用Tracker优化告别龟速下载时代
  • Excel二维码生成终极指南:一键自动更新插件安装教程
  • 【EVE-NG流量洞察】2、802.1Q VLAN
  • GitHub镜像网站推荐:解决huggingface下载慢的终极方案
  • 贴吧垂直领域引流:针对性强但需注意规则
  • 专业级纽扣电池座子封装库:让您的嵌入式设计更高效
  • Arduino图形库终极指南:10分钟掌握嵌入式显示开发
  • 深度评测:Elk如何重塑Mastodon的Web体验?
  • P1829 [国家集训队] Crash的数字表格 / JZPTAB
  • 普通Windows电脑也能畅享三星笔记:智能伪装技术全解析
  • GNU Emacs窗口管理终极指南:从新手到专家的完整教程
  • 当学术写作不再是“翻译思维”,而是一场与学科话语的深度对话——书匠策AI如何助力研究者跨越表达鸿沟
  • 物联网传感器网络嵌入智能推理能力
  • 揭秘VSCode差异查看隐藏功能:99%的开发者都不知道的高效调试秘诀
  • 支持微调的大模型和不支持微调的解决方案
  • AR眼镜搭载本地模型实现即时交互
  • 【EVE-NG流量洞察】3、802.1ad (Q-IN-Q)
  • 【VSCode多模型切换配置秘籍】:掌握高效开发环境的终极武器
  • 大模型蒸馏
  • 从零部署open-notebook:Docker容器化方案详解
  • Notion数据库管理模型实验记录模板分享
  • 【VSCode行内聊天黑科技】:揭秘代码编辑效率提升300%的隐藏功能
  • 2025年评价高的不锈钢耙式真空干燥机/农药耙式真空干燥机厂家推荐及选购指南 - 品牌宣传支持者
  • VVQuest:简单快速的表情包智能搜索终极指南
  • 兼容主流标准便于与其他系统集成
  • 快速自然语言处理标注技术解析
  • YOLOv8 CutOut数据增强集成效果
  • 2025年知名的气膜冰雪乐园厂家最新权威推荐排行榜 - 品牌宣传支持者